Key Responsibilities
* Operate CNC milling machines to produce high-quality precision components.
* Read and interpret technical drawings to ensure accurate machining.
* Maintain machinery and tooling, ensuring safe and efficient operation.
* Use hand tools for adjustments and basic assembly tasks.
* Inspect finished components to ensure they meet required tolerances.
* Work collaboratively with the wider team to support smooth production flow.
* Identify and troubleshoot machining issues, making adjustments as needed.
